Michelle Hartman

31 books

121 pages paperback 2009

fiction contemporary funny reflective fast-paced

288 pages paperback 2015

fiction mystery short stories challenging mysterious reflective fast-paced

138 pages 2013

poetry challenging reflective slow-paced

100 pages paperback

nonfiction poetry

152 pages 2018

nonfiction challenging emotional reflective medium-paced

128 pages 2002

fiction challenging reflective slow-paced

128 pages 2002

fiction reflective slow-paced

266 pages hardcover

nonfiction philosophy politics challenging informative reflective medium-paced

missing page info 2019

fiction childrens emotional lighthearted slow-paced

358 pages 2014

challenging informative reflective medium-paced